Block

#21,138,712
Block Number
21,138,712 @ 03/14/2025, 01:35:30
Status
Finalized
ID
0x01428d18f630c27461121ff2a0a8a67cec09c8cc071b82e3398686224695878a
Transactions
Gas Used
10663231/40000000 (26.66% Used)
Total Score
2,063,872,123 (+99)
Rewards
32.07 VTHO